> Is there any way to disable the built in wifi in the pi3? I put a
> picoreplayer with touchscreen in an old macintosh classic. Worked fine
> including lms om a pi3 except for that the macintosh case is screened so
> the pi3 wifi does not work. I wold like to put an external usb wifi
> adapter on the outside of the case. But on the pi3 both wifi cards get
> the wlan0 device. So it would be great if there was a way to turn of or
> disable the builtin wifi.
> Regards
> Nils

Not sure about pico because of the ramdisk nature of it, but on a RW
file system, I'd blacklist the module by creating
"/etc/modprobe.d/blacklist-brcmfmac.conf", with contents...

Code:
--------------------
    
  blacklist brcmfmac
  
--------------------
